Explore. Discover. Innovate. Journalists: Apply for a Nieman Fellowship at Harvard University
The Nieman Foundation is now accepting applications for fellows in the class of 2026. Approximately two dozen journalists from around the world will be selected to spend the 2025-2026 academic year at Harvard University, where they will audit classes with some of the university’s greatest thinkers, participate in Nieman programming and collaborate with peers. During their time at Harvard, Nieman Fellows attend seminars, shop talks and master classes designed to strengthen their professional skills and leadership capabilities. With the knowledge they gain on campus and the relationships they build, fellows often return to work as journalism entrepreneurs, industry innovators and top managers in their newsrooms.
